КАКОВ vs КАКОЙ

First of all, we must say that the word "каков" is becoming less and less common, so what I will be talking about below is more of a RECOMMENDATION. In some cases, the word "каков" is more preferable, but often in colloquial speech, native speakers ignore these differences.
ОЦЕНКА / EVALUATION
КАКОЙ is used in questions, when there are suggested options that don't give specific information (like большой/маленький – large/small, высокий/низкий – high/low);
КАКОВ is used in questions, when one needs MORE PRECISE answer.
Please, compare the following examples and note the sentence structure:
— Какова́ высота́ э́той горы́? // What is the height of this mountain?
— Высота́ э́той горы́ составля́ет 2 178 метров. // The height of this mountain is 2,178 meters.
— Кака́я высота́ у э́той горы́? /// What is the height of this mountain?
— Дово́льно больша́я.// Pretty big.
========================================================
ОЦЕНКА, КОГДА В ОТВЕТЕ ОЖИДАЕТСЯ КРАТКОЕ ПРИЛАГАТЕЛЬНОЕ:
EVALUATION, WHEN A SHORT ADJECTIVE IS EXPECTED IN THE ANSWER:
— Каково тебе было изучать венгерский язык? // What was it like for you to learn Hungarian?
— Поначалу было труднО, но через год я уже довольно хорошо говорил. // At first it was hard, but after a year I spoke quite well.
OR:
— Было интереснО. / It was interesting.
So here we are interested in the person's attitude to the learning process.
And now compare these ones with как-questions and the corresponding answers:
Как ты изучал венге́рский язык? // How did you learn the Hungarian language?
— Я изучал его в университе́те. // I studied it at the university.
OR
— Я изучал его самостоя́тельно. // I studied it on my own.
OR
— Я изучал его с репети́тором. / I studied it with a tutor.
OR
— Меня научила моя жена́-венге́рка. // My Hungarian wife taught me.
Thus, unlike каково-questions, как-questions implie the way of learning.
========================================================
КАКОЙ – ВНЕШНИЕ ПРИЗНАКИ (EXTERNAL SIGNS)
КАКОВ – СОДЕРЖАНИЕ (INTERNAL CONTENT)
— У тебя новый парень? Расскажи, какой он. // Do you have a new boyfriend? Tell me what he is like. (here the questioner wants to know how would most people see him, and here the questioner would probably here standard superficial characteristics)
— Ну, он мой ровесник, высокий, накачанный, учится на юриста. // Well, he's my age, tall, beefy, studying to be a lawyer.
— У тебя новый парень? Расскажи, каков он. // Do you have a new boyfriend? Tell me what he is like. (the questioner wants to know how exactly you see him, because you know him much better)
— Он такой умный, добрый, ласковый, так мило улыбается…
OR (the same idea, but formulated with the short adjectives):
— Он так умён, добр, ла́сков, так мило улыбается… // He is so smart, kind, affectionate, smiles so sweetly...
========================================================
ВОСКЛИЦАНИЯ (выражающие, как правило, негативную оценку):
EXCLAMATIONS (usually expressing a negative assessment):
— У него на счета́х миллионы, а он мне даже сто́льник одолжи́ть не захотел. Каков жмот! // He has millions in his accounts, but he didn’t even want to lend me a steward. What a meanie!
Notes:
- "Каков жмот!" sounds more expressive than "Какой жмот!".
- сто́льник = 100 рублей
Я у него только время спросил, а он меня сразу матом послал. Каков грубия́н! // I just asked him for the time, and replied: "F*ck you". What a cad!
========================================================
Here I would also mention the word ТАКО́В (ТАКОВА́, ТАКОВО́, ТАКОВЫ́), which can be used instead of "такой", when we summarize something:
Бла-бла-бла… – таково моё мнение / такое у меня мнение
Blah blah blah… – this is my opinion
Бла-бла-бла… – такова моя позиция / такая у меня позиция
Blah blah blah… – this is my position
Бла-бла-бла… – таковы основные сложности, возникающие при изучении языка суахили.
Blah blah blah... – these are the main difficulties that arise when learning the Swahili language.
Бла-бла-бла… – такие сложности возникают при изучении языка суахили.
Blah blah blah... – such difficulties arise when learning the Swahili language.
